在数据驱动的时代,企业的成功往往取决于其对数据的有效管理和充分利用。然而,面对庞大的数据量和复杂的数据库结构,许多企业在同步数据时遇到了重重困难。传统的数据同步方法不仅难以满足实时性要求,还可能导致数据库的暂时不可用,给企业业务带来不小的风险。在这样的背景下,选择合适的数据库同步工具变得尤为重要。本文将深入探讨企业如何选择数据库同步工具,并提供一份实用的指南,帮助企业在数字化转型中做出明智的决策。

🚀 一、了解数据库同步的必要性
1. 数据同步的核心价值
数据同步不仅是技术上的需求,更是业务发展的驱动力。通过高效的数据同步,企业可以确保信息的一致性和完整性,从而提高决策的准确性和速度。在竞争激烈的市场环境中,实时获取和分析数据能够帮助企业快速响应市场变化,优化资源配置和管理策略。
例如,在电商行业,库存数据的实时更新对于销售策略的调整至关重要。一个延迟的库存同步可能导致销售预测失准,影响企业收益。类似地,金融行业需要实时更新客户交易信息,以减少违规风险并提高客户满意度。
- 提高运营效率:数据同步可以减少数据孤岛现象,促进跨部门协作。
- 增强数据准确性:实时同步能够减少数据误差,提高决策的可靠性。
- 提升客户体验:通过及时更新客户信息,提供更个性化的服务。
2. 数据库同步的挑战
尽管数据库同步能带来诸多好处,但实施过程中也面临许多挑战。大数据环境下的数据量和复杂性是企业必须解决的首要问题。传统的批量同步和全量重写策略往往难以满足实时性需求,还可能导致系统性能下降。

例如,某企业在实施数据同步时遇到了网络延迟问题,导致数据传输缓慢,影响了关键业务流程。这种情况下,选择适合的工具来优化数据传输路径和方式显得尤为重要。
挑战点 | 描述 | 影响 |
---|---|---|
数据量庞大 | 数据库规模巨大,影响传输速度 | 增加同步时间,影响实时性 |
网络延迟 | 数据传输受网络环境影响 | 数据不及时,影响决策 |
系统兼容性问题 | 不同系统间数据格式不一致 | 需要额外处理,增加复杂性 |
🔍 二、选择数据库同步工具的关键标准
1. 实时性和可靠性
在选择数据库同步工具时,实时性和可靠性是两个最重要的考虑因素。一个高效的同步工具应能在最短时间内完成数据传输,同时确保数据的准确性和完整性。FineDataLink(FDL)在这方面表现出色,它能够支持实时的全量和增量同步,无论数据源是单表、多表还是整库。
例如,某金融企业选择FDL进行数据同步,在处理日均数百万条交易数据时,FDL通过低延迟的实时同步功能,显著提高了数据处理效率,并确保了数据的可靠性。
- 低延迟传输:保证数据的及时性。
- 高效错误处理:在传输过程中自动检测和修正错误,确保数据准确性。
- 多源兼容:支持不同数据源的同步,适应复杂的企业环境。
2. 易用性和可扩展性
另一个需要考虑的标准是工具的易用性和可扩展性。低代码平台能够降低开发难度,让企业专注于业务逻辑的实现。同时,可扩展的工具能够根据企业的需求增长灵活调整和扩展同步能力。
FDL作为低代码平台,在易用性上拥有明显优势。它提供直观的用户界面和丰富的配置选项,能够快速上手并实施复杂的同步任务。
- 用户友好界面:降低学习成本,提高工作效率。
- 灵活配置选项:满足不同数据同步需求。
- 支持多种扩展:根据业务增长灵活调整同步性能。
3. 成本效益分析
选择数据库同步工具时,成本效益分析至关重要。企业需要评估工具的总拥有成本(TCO)和潜在的业务收益。一个理想的工具应在提供高性能的同时,保证合理的成本投入。
FDL不仅提供高性能的同步功能,还通过低代码特性降低开发和维护成本,是企业进行成本效益分析时的理想选择。
- 降低开发成本:减少开发时间和人力资源投入。
- 降低维护成本:自动化错误处理和性能优化,减少后期维护需求。
- 提高业务收益:通过高效数据管理,改善业务流程和决策质量。
标准 | 描述 | FDL优势 |
---|---|---|
实时性和可靠性 | 确保数据及时准确传输 | 低延迟,高效错误处理 |
易用性和可扩展性 | 降低开发难度,支持灵活扩展 | 用户友好界面,灵活配置选项 |
成本效益分析 | 评估工具成本和业务收益 | 降低开发维护成本,提高业务收益 |
📊 三、评估和实施数据库同步工具
1. 工具评估流程
在具体实施过程中,企业首先需要进行详细的工具评估。评估流程应包括需求分析、功能测试和性能评估,以确保选择的工具能满足企业的实际需求。
例如,某企业在选择数据库同步工具时,首先进行了详细的需求分析,确定了数据同步的关键需求,如实时性和兼容性。接着,他们对备选工具进行了功能测试,评估工具的同步能力和错误处理机制。最后,通过性能评估验证工具在高负载情况下的表现,确保其能够支持企业的业务增长。
- 需求分析:明确企业数据同步的关键需求。
- 功能测试:验证工具的同步能力和错误处理机制。
- 性能评估:评估工具在高负载情况下的表现。
2. 工具实施策略
选择工具后,企业需要制定详细的实施策略。实施策略应包括工具的配置、数据迁移和后期维护,以确保同步任务的顺利进行。
FDL的低代码特性使其在实施过程中能够快速配置和调整,减少了数据迁移的复杂性。同时,FDL提供自动化的维护机制,帮助企业在后期优化同步性能。
- 工具配置:根据企业需求快速配置同步任务。
- 数据迁移:确保数据在不同系统间的顺利迁移。
- 后期维护:通过自动化机制优化同步性能。
3. 成功案例分享
许多企业成功实施数据库同步工具后,显著改善了数据管理和业务流程。这些成功案例不仅展示了工具的强大功能,也为其他企业提供了宝贵的经验。
例如,某制造企业通过FDL实现了供应链数据的实时同步,优化了库存管理和订单处理流程,显著提高了运营效率。

- 改善库存管理:实时更新库存数据,减少库存积压。
- 优化订单处理:提高订单处理速度,减少订单错误。
- 提高运营效率:通过数据优化改善业务流程。
📚 结语
选择合适的数据库同步工具是企业数据管理和数字化转型的关键步骤。本文从数据库同步的必要性、工具选择的关键标准,以及评估和实施的具体策略进行了详细探讨。希望这份指南能帮助企业做出明智的决策,推动业务的持续发展。
引用文献:
- 《数据管理与分析:理论与实践》,John Wiley & Sons出版社。
- 《企业数字化转型指南》,Harvard Business Review出版社。
- 《高效数据同步技术》,Springer出版社。
更多信息和体验,可以访问: FineDataLink体验Demo 。
本文相关FAQs
🤔 企业为什么需要数据库同步工具?
最近老板一直在讨论企业数字化转型,提到数据库同步工具的重要性。可是我不太清楚,为什么企业一定要使用这些工具呢?有没有大佬能分享一下,企业在进行数据库同步时面临的具体挑战是什么?
在企业数字化转型的过程中,数据库同步工具成为不可或缺的一部分。首先,企业的数据量级庞大,种类繁多,如何高效管理和实时更新这些数据是一个巨大挑战。想象一下,如果数据不能同步,营销部和销售部看到的客户信息不一致,可能会造成决策失误。而且,数据的更新频率和实时性对生产运营、客户服务等多个业务领域至关重要。数据库同步工具可以帮助企业实现数据的实时同步,保证信息的一致性和准确性。此外,传统的手动同步方式不仅费时费力,还容易出错,而自动化的同步工具则能大大提高效率和准确性。这对于企业来说,不仅是提高工作效率的问题,更是提升决策质量、优化客户体验的关键。
📊 如何选择合适的数据库同步工具?
有了初步了解之后,我开始研究市面上的数据库同步工具,但发现选择太多了。不同工具有不同的特点和适用场景,我该如何选择合适的工具呢?有没有具体的选择标准或实操经验可以分享?
选择合适的数据库同步工具需要考虑多个因素,当然也包括企业的具体需求和技术环境。首先,要明确企业的数据规模和类型。对于数据量庞大的企业,工具的处理能力和扩展性是首要考虑因素。其次,不同的工具在数据同步的实时性、容错性、易用性上表现各异。比如,有些工具支持实时同步,而有些工具则更适合批量处理。再者,考虑工具的兼容性和集成能力,确保它能无缝连接企业现有的技术架构。此外,成本也是一个重要因素,企业需要在性能和预算之间取得平衡。**
选择标准 | 示例工具 | 特点 |
---|---|---|
实时性 | Kafka | 支持实时数据流 |
扩展性 | Apache NiFi | 高度可扩展 |
易用性 | FineDataLink | 低代码操作,用户友好 |
兼容性 | Talend | 多源支持 |
在这里,我推荐 FineDataLink体验Demo ,它是一个低代码、高时效的企业级数据集成平台,适合在大数据场景下进行实时和离线数据采集与管理。
🔄 企业如何实现高性能的实时数据同步?
了解了工具选择的基本原则后,我想深入研究如何在实际操作中实现高性能的实时数据同步。特别是面对大数据环境时,企业该如何突破技术瓶颈,实现高效的数据同步呢?
在大数据环境下实现高性能的实时数据同步,企业需要从技术架构和流程优化两方面着手。首先,选择支持实时数据流的工具,比如Kafka或FineDataLink,它们能够处理大规模数据流并保证低延迟。其次,企业需优化数据传输路径,通过减少数据处理环节来提升效率。同时,合理配置服务器资源,确保系统在处理大规模数据时不出现瓶颈。对于数据量特别大的情况,可以考虑分布式架构来分散负载。此外,定期监控同步过程,使用性能监测工具及时发现和解决问题也是关键。企业还需关注数据安全和容错机制,确保同步过程中数据的准确性和可靠性。通过这些策略,企业不仅可以实现高性能的实时数据同步,还能为未来的扩展和创新打下坚实基础。